- 1. Regulatory Limits: The dose to a member of the public fi'om direct radiation, liquid andgaseous effluents released friom each unit to areas at or beyond site boundary shall belimited to the following:
- a. Fission and Activation products:
- i. Tech Spec Whole Body: 500 norero/year ii. Tech Spec Skin: 3000 morem/year
- b. Particulates with half-lives
> 8 days, tritium and Iodine:i. Tech Spec Organ: 1500 orero/year ii. 1 OCFR50 Organ: 7.5 mrem/quarter, 15 mrem/year
- c. Liquid Effluents:
- i. IOCFR50 Whole body: 1.5 mrem/quarter, 3 mrem/year ii. IOCFR50 Organ: 5 torem/quarter.
10 torem/year
- d. Combined dose to real individual beyond controlled area:i. 10CFR72 Whole body: 25 torem/year ii. IOCFR72 Thyroid:
75 mrem/year iii. 1OCFR72 Organ: 25 mrem/year
- 2. Effluent Concentration Limits (ECL): Limits used in determining allowable release ratesor concentrations.
- a. Gaseous Effluents:
I OCFR20 Appendix B Table 2 Column 1.b. Liquid Effluents:
10 X IOCFR20 Appendix B Table 2 Column 2.3. Measurements and Approximations of Total Radioactivity.
- a. Fission and Activation Products:
100% Kr-85 is assumed in calculations sinceother isotopes have decayed.
Vent stack activity is continuously monitored forfission and activation gases.b. Particulate and tritium releases are continuously monitored and samples collected and analyzed weekly. Particulate filters are sent to an independent lab forquarterly composite analysis.
Tritium activity is monitored in gaseous releasesfrom evaporation of water in the spent fuel pool and water filled reactor cavities.
- c. Liquid effluents are continuously monitored and isotopic analysis performed weekly.d. Occupancy factors to accurately estimate dose due to habits of the real individual that are used to calculate maximum exposed member of the public are discussed in ES&H Technical Support Document 13-009 "Member of the Public Dose fromAll Onsite Sources."
- 4. Batch Releases:
- a. Liquid: There were no liquid batch releases in 2013.b. Gaseous:
There were no gaseous batch releases in 2013.5. Abnormal Releases:
- a. Liquid: There were no liquid abnormal releases in 2013.b. Gaseous:
there were no gaseous abnormal releases in 2013.

Gaseous and Liquid Waste Treatment Systems and Process Control ProgramZion Station ODCM Section 12.7.2 pursuant to ODCM Section 12.7.4 requires majorchanges to the Gaseous and Liquid Waste Treatment Systems to be reported in theAnnual Radioactive Effluent Release Report. There are major changes ongoing with thephysical configuration of the liquid radwaste system. along with associated DSAR andODCM descriptive changes; however the changes were not completed and furtherrevisions were being evaluated as of Dec. 3 1, 2013; therefore the completed changepackage will be submitted in the reporting year during which the change was complete.
Zion Station ODCM Section 12.6.2 requires major changes to the Process ControlProgram(PCP) to be submitted in the Annual Radioactive Effluent Release Report. Therewere no major changes to the PCP.The Waste Gas Hold-up System was permanently vented. In Zion's defueledconfiguration this system is no longer applicable.
In Zion's defueled configuration, the charcoal iodine removal system is no longerapplicable.
Due to radioactive decay and no means of production, radioactive iodine is not a concernat Zion.7. Limiting Conditions of Operation (LCOs)Zion Station ODCM Section 12.7.2 requires explanation as to why the inoperability ofliquid or gaseous monitoring instrumentation was not corrected within the time specified in the ODCM to be submitted with the Annual Radioactive Effluent Release Report.There are no such occurrences.
- 8. Liquid Holdup Tanks and Gas Storage TanksZion Station ODCM Section 12.7.2 requires a description of events leading to liquidholdup tanks or gas storage tanks exceeding technical specification limits to be includedin the Annual Radioactive Effluent Release Report.The contents of the six gas decay tanks have been sampled and determined to havenegligible activity.
The Gas Decay Tanks have been abandoned in place.No liquid holdup tanks exceeded the limits of Permanently Defueled Technical Specifications 5.6.3 during 2013.9. Offsite Dose Calculation Manual (ODCM)Changes to the ODCM are required by Zion Station Permanently Defueled Technical Specification 5.6. 1. and ODCM Section 12.6.3 to be submitted as part of, or concurrent with, the Annual Radioactive Effluent Release Report.

& Waste Disposal SummaryAttachment 2.6-Error Estimation Estimates of Total ErrorThe following is a calculated estimate of the maximum potential total error associated with reported values in the Annual Radioactive Effluent Release Report. The Total Erroris determined by calculating the square root of the sum of the squares of the individual errors.a. Gaseous Effluents Sampling ErrorCalibration ErrorCounting Statistics ErrorSsninle Vcinhrn FErrnr5%10%17%1 0%Total Error 23%b. Liquid Effluents Sampling Error 5%Calibration Error 10%Counting Statistics Error 16%Sample Volume Error 2%Total Error 20%
